[Interns at an American investment management company earn $250,000 a year, higher than the chairman of the Federal Reserve and the British Prime Minister] According to an article in the Financial Times on October 15, the annual salary of interns at Jane Street Capital, an American quantitative trading and investment management company, is as high as $250,000, higher than the $246,000 of the chairman of the Federal Reserve and the $223,000 of the British Prime Minister. The article pointed out that Jane Street Capital has posted many job openings on its official website and listed the basic salary range as $250,000 to $300,000 a year, and even pointed out that "this is only part of the total compensation, which includes an annual discretionary bonus" and does not include various bonus benefits. Even the trading desk engineering interns with a lower threshold have an annual salary of $175,000. According to public information, Jane Street Capital was established in 1999 and is headquartered in New York City, USA. Jane Street Capital's net trading income has exceeded $10 billion for four consecutive years, and its total trading income has exceeded $21.9 billion. It has more than 2,600 employees, and the amount of employee compensation and benefits last year was as high as $2.4 billion, with an average of $920,000 per employee.
